Today’s show took a different turn as we welcomed Spanish artist and lecturer Carmen González Castro for a deep, thought-provoking conversation about censorship, nudity, and how classical ideals still shape our perceptions of the body today. Known for her richly layered canvases that blend Greco-Roman myth with baroque distortion, Carmen offered powerful insight into why nudity in art—and society—still provokes such debate.
Today’s unpopular opinion was “Adult nudity should never be censored.”
In the show’s second half, we asked 100 humans to name a place where you’re going to be naked—and yes, it got weird in all the best ways.
